Common Interest Developments

In addition to various forms of rental housing (including family, senior, and special needs), The John Stewart Company manages housing cooperatives and common interest developments. Working closely with the Boards of cooperative corporations and homeowners associations, we provide the full range of specialized services required for both market-rate and affordable homeownership developments.

JSCo's expertise in managing both rental and common interest developments has greatly benefited clients that are converting apartments to condominiums (as we can seamlessly transfer management duties as units convert) or are developing properties with both rental and ownership components (as JSCo can manage the entire property).
